Method for testing dispersion rate of pavement granular fiber in asphalt mixture

2016 
The invention relates to a method for testing the dispersion rate of a pavement granular fiber in an asphalt mixture. The method comprises the following steps: preparing an asphalt mixture according to parameters defined by a production mixing proportion and a blending process, determining run-off loss delta m, asphalt-aggregate ratio A' and mineral aggregate gradation G', and judging whether the asphalt-aggregate ratio A' and the mineral aggregate gradation G' satisfy the requirements of the production mixing proportion; according to the asphalt-aggregate ratio A' and the mineral aggregate gradation G', adding different nx% of artificial completely dispersed granular fibers, determining run-off loss delta mx, and establishing a mathematical model with respect to nx% and the run-off loss delta mx for the completely dispersed granular fiber content C in the asphalt mixture; and then, substituting the run-off loss delta m of the asphalt mixture produced by a blending plant in the mathematical model to obtain the completely dispersed granular fiber content C' in the asphalt mixture, and calculating the dispersion rate of the granular fiber in the asphalt mixture. According to the method, the dispersion rate of the granular fiber in the asphalt mixture can be determined, thereby achieving the purposes of optimizing the blending process and strengthening production quality control.
